فهرست مطالببستن
  • فرمت WebP چیه؟
  • بررسی جوانب مثبت و منفی این فرمت
    • مزایا
    • معایب
  • تبدیل به فرمت WebP
  • نحوه استفاده از تصاویر WebP در وردپرس
  • Optimole
  • نتیجه

فرمت عکس WebP چیه؟ جوانب مثبت و منفی این فرمت رو بررسی کردین؟ باید در جریان باشین که درست پشت گوش ما یه نوع جنگ فناوری در جریان هست. این جنگ فرمت خاص همه ما رو درگیر می‌کنه و به احتمال زیاد شما مبارزان اون رو حتی بدون دونستن اون دیدین. ما در حقیقت در مورد نسل بعدی قالب تصویر وب صحبت می‌کنیم و در حال حاضر باید بدونین که فرمت WebP جلوتر از بقیه حرکت می‌کنه. اما این مسئله فقط سوالات بیشتری رو ایجاد می‌کنه. یعنی اصلاً WebP چیه؟ و چه مشکلاتی با JPEG ها داره؟ با تشکر از صاحب اون یعنی گوگل، فرمت WebP اخیراً به یه موضوع داغ تبدیل شده. این مورد در دستگاه‌های بیشتری پذیرفته می‌شه (که باعث نارضایتی رقبای JPEG 2000 و JPEG XR می‌شه) و در حال تبدیل شدن به فرمت جدید پیش فرض وب هست. با وجود تمام جزئیات پیچیده فنی، برای هر کسی که تصاویر رو به صورت آنلاین ارسال می‌کنه، WebP یه معامله بزرگ هست. بنابراین در این راهنما، همه مواردی رو که باید بدونین چیه و نحوه استفاده از اون و این که چرا باید مراقبت کنیم، توضیح خواهیم داد. ما نکات مثبت و منفی این فرمت رو با شما بررسی می‌کنیم و سپس به شما نشون می‌دیم که چطوری سایر فرمت‌های خود رو تبدیل کنین. بد نیست مرتبط با این مقاله در مورد تصاویر لیزی لود هم اطلاعاتی داشته باشین.

فرمت WebP چیه؟

با نادیده گرفتن همه اخبار اخیر، فرمت عکس WebP در حقیقت کاملاً قدیمی هست. اولین بار در سال ۲۰۱۰ اعلام شد و از اون زمان تا کنون در حال ارتقا و بهبودی هست. این موضوع اخیراً به عنوان موضوعی پرطرفدار در جنگ‌های فرمت بعدی نسل بعدی مطرح شده. برای درک واقعی آنچه که فرمت WebP رو منحصر به فرد می‌کنه، به شما کمک می‌کنه تا ابتدا همه فرمت‌های فایل تصویر و تفاوت اونها رو درک کنین؛ اما برای سرعت بخشیدن به همه چیز در این مقاله، ما مستقیماً به نقطه اصلی فروش فشرده سازی WebP خواهیم پیوست. اگه با این اصطلاح آشنا نیستین باید بگیم که فشرده سازی به رمزگذاری داده‌های پرونده در بخش‌های کمتر یا قطعه داده‌های دیجیتال نسبت به نسخه اصلی اشاره داره. فشرده سازی دو نوع اصلی داره:

  • lossless: در این روش از فشرده سازی کیفیت تصویر با پایین اومدن اندازه داده ثابت می‌مونه.
  • lossy: در این روش از فشرده سازی با کاهش قابل توجه اندازه داده، کیفیت تصویر کمی پایین می‌آید.

اگه می‌خواهید که جادوی این مسئله رو بدونین که چطوری می‌تونین اندازه پرونده رو بدون تاثیر بر کیفیت اون کاهش بدین، این راهنما به خوبی برای شما همه چیز رو توضیح می‌ده. به بیان ساده، تصاویر با فرمت WebP معمولاً به لطف فشرده سازی برتر، کوچک‌تر از تصاویر مشابه خود هستن اما همان کیفیت رو دارن. این مسئله به آن معنا هست که استفاده از تصاویر WebP برای سایت خود معمولاً باعث سرعت بخشیدن به اون و کاهش هم زمان ذخیره اطلاعات شما می‌شه.

چقدر کوچک‌تر؟ طبق داده‌های خود گوگل فشرده سازی بدون افت ۲۶% WebP کوچک‌تر از PNG و فشرده سازی lossy اون ۲۵ تا ۳۴% کوچک‌تر از JPEG هست. برای سایت‌هایی که از تصاویر زیادی استفاده می‌کنن، تغییر حالت می‌تونه تاثیر قابل توجهی ایجاد کنه و میلی ثانیه ارزش بارگیری رو به خصوص در تلفن همراه اصلاح کنه. در حقیقت نوعی بهینه سازی وب سایت برای موبایل محسوب می‌شه. مزیت‌های اصلی دیگه فرمت WebP قابلیت انعطاف پذیری اون هست. این مزیت در حقیقت از شفافیت و انیمیشن بهره می‌بره. این در حقیقت می‌تونه یه معضل بزرگ هم باشه چون معمولاً اون ویژگی‌ها رو با همون فرمت پیدا نمی‌کنین. قبل از WebP باید از PNG برای پس زمینه‌های شفاف و GIF برای انیمیشن‌ها استفاده کنین. در نظر داشته باشین که هیچ چیز به طور هم زمان از هر دو پشتیبانی نمی‌کنه. این عملکرد عالی همراه با رای اعتماد از طرف گوگل، واقعاً راه رو برای تبدیل شدن فرمت WebP به فرمت جدید پیش فرض پرونده وب باز می‌کنه.

بررسی جوانب مثبت و منفی این فرمت

فرمت عکس WebP

فرمت عکس WebP همونطور که تاثیرگذار هست، اما کاملاً آماده نیست. بیاید قبل از هر چیزی به  موارد مثبت و منفی فرمت WebP نگاهی بندازیم و ببینیم که آیا برای شما و رفع نیازهای شما مناسب هست یا نه!

مزایا

  • زمان بارگیری سریع‌تر: به دلیل کوچک‌تر بودن اندازه پرونده، صفحات دارای تصاویر با فرمت WebP سریع‌تر بارگیری می‌شن. این مسئله یه افزایش چشم‌گیر برای لذت بردن از سایت هست و تجربه کاربری خوبی رو برای کاربران با خود به همراه میاره. این مسئله می‌تونه باعث بهینه سازی وب سایت شما بشه. به گفته کارشناس سازنده وب سایت، هر ثانیه تاخیر در بارگیری رضایت بازدیدکننده رو تا ۱۶% کاهش می‌ده و اگه در ۴ ثانیه بارگیری نشه؛ از هر ۱۰ بازدیدکننده، ۴ نفر سایت شما رو به طور کامل رها می‌کنن.
  • فضای ذخیره سازی کمتر رسانه: فشرده سازی پیشرفته WebP همچنین به معنای فضای ذخیره سازی کمتر هست. این مسئله برای سایت‌هایی هست که میزبان تعداد زیادی تصویر هستن و بسیار مهمه که حتی در هزینه هاستینگ وب خود صرفه جویی کنن.
  • شفافیت و انیمیشن: همونطور که در بالا اشاره کردیم، WebP تنها فرمت تصویری هست که از پس زمینه‌های شفاف PNG و فرمت‌های انیمیشن GIF پشتیبانی می‌کنه. البته نیازی به گفتن این مسئله نیست که فشرده سازی JPEG بهتر هست.

معایب

  • توسط همه مرورگرها پشتیبانی نمی‌شه: اگر چه فرمت عکس WebP سهم شیرینی از مرورگرها داره اما هنوز هم برخی از مرورگرها از اون پشتیبانی نمی‌کنن (اینترنت اکسپلورر در پذیرش اون کند هست که این مسئله برای اینترنت اکسپلورر مناسب هست) در حقیقت یک راه حل برای اون وجود داره که شامل ایجاد یک تصویر برگشتی در HTML هست؛ اما ایجاد یک فایل کامل دیگه به عنوان پشتیبان، گاهی اوقات فضای ذخیره سازی اضافی رو که با استفاده از فرمت WebP صرفه جویی می‌کنین، نفی می‌کنه.
  • کیفیت هنوز هم کاهش می‌یابد: این مسئله تنها نقطه ضعف برای فرمت WebP نیست بلکه نقطه ضعف و عیبی برای تمام فشرده سازی‌ها محسوب می‌شه. در هر حالت کیفیت تصویر شما کاهش می‌یابد. برای بیشتر افراد این موضوع ناچیز هست اما در نظر داشته باشین که برای سایت‌های بصری مانند نمونه کارهای عکاسی یا طراحی گرافیکی، شما کیفیت بصری خود رو در حداکثر ممکن می‌خواید.

تبدیل به فرمت WebP

فرمت عکس WebP

اگه قبلاً اندازه‌های پرونده‌های کوچک‌تر رو فروختین، طبیعتاً برای تغییر همه تصاویر به یک مبدل تصویر فرمت WebP نیاز دارین. بسیاری از نرم افزارها از فرمت عکس WebP پشتیبانی می‌کنن، بنابراین می‌تونین اونها رو مستقیماً از منبع ایجاد کنین اما اگه تصاویر قبلی دارین یا از جایی اومدین که از فرمت WebP پشتیبانی نمی‌کنه، به مبدل تصویر نیاز دارین. موارد زیادی برای انتخاب وجود داره و در حقیقت بیشتر اونها در انجام وظیفه اصلی تبدیل یه فایل به WebP موفق می‌شن. یه مثال شفاف Xn convert هست. Xn convert برای ویندوز و مک و لینوکس کار می‌کنه. همچنین برای استفاده شخصی رایگان هست، اگرچه مجوز استفاده از شرکت رو باید خریداری کنین، علاوه بر WebP از JPEG، TIFF، PNG، JPEG 2000، GIF، داده خام و دوربین و صدها مورد دیگه پشتیبانی می‌کنه. ویژگی‌های زیادی نیز وجود داره: تبدیل دسته‌ای، چرخش، افزودن علامت‎‌های آبی، افزودن متن و تنظیمات تصویر نور مانند سایه‌ها و روشنایی زیاد! البته اگه فقط قصد دارین که تعداد انگشت شماری از تصاویر رو تبدیل کنین، همیشه می‌تونین با یه گزینه حتی ساده‌تر هم پیش برین. برای مثال Ezgif یه مبدل آنلاین رایگان برای فرمت WebP هست. شما همچنین ویژگی‌های پیشرفته‌تر رو در Xn convert پیدا نخواهید کرد؛ اما اگه نگرانی شما سرعت و سهولت کار هست، باید بگیم که می‌تونه نیازهای شما رو پوشش بده.

نحوه استفاده از تصاویر WebP در وردپرس

البته به عنوان یک کاربر وردپرس کاقی نیست که بپرسین فرمت عکس WebP چیه؟ همچنین باید بدونین که آیا می‌تونین از این نوع تصویر در کنار وردپرس استفاده کنین یا نه! درست مثل مرورگرها، هر سازنده وب سایت و سیستم مدیریت محتوا CMS از فرمت WebP پشتیبانی نمی‌کنه! خبر بد این که وردپرس در حال حاضر به طور پیش فرض از تصاویر با فرمت WebP پشتیبانی نمی‌کنه. با همه این موارد شما هنوز هم می‌تونین از این فرمت در سایت خود استفاده کنین فقط به یک یا چند ابزار اضافی نیاز داره.

Optimole

Optimole راه حل جدید ما برای بهینه سازی تصویر هست که دارای ویژگی‌های بسیار جذابی هست. با این علاوه بر این که می‌تونین تمام تصاویر خود رو به صورت خودکار بهینه کنین و سپس اونها رو از طریق CDN ارائه بدین، می‌تونین از مزایای تصویر با فرمت WebP هم استفاده کنین. در روشی که Optimole تصاویر WebP رو فعال می‌کنه بسیار جالب هست. اگه مرورگر بازدیدکننده از تصاویر پشتیبانی بکنه، این افزونه به طور خودکار تصاویر شما رو به WebP تبدیل می‌کنه. اگه مرورگر از فرمت WebP پشتیبانی نکنه، نسخه عادی تصویر برای کاربر یا بازدیدکننده ارائه می‌شه. اگه قصد دارین با موارد موجود بیشتری آزمایش کنین، ابزارهای دیگه‌ای نیز وجود داره که تصاویر  WebP رو فعال می‌کنه:

  • jetpack دارای یه ماژول CDN تصویری هست که با تصاویر WebP کار می‌کنه.
  • همچنین می‌تونینWebP رو با ترکیب ShortPixel / EWWW Image Optimizer با Cache Enabler فعال کنین. هر دوی این افزونه‌های بهینه سازی تصویر به شما امکان می‌دهن تا JPEGها و PNGهای خود رو به تصاویر با فرمت WebP تبدیل کنین. سپس می‌تونین از افزونه Cache Enabler استفاده کنین تا در واقع این فایل‌ها رو به مرورگرهایی که از این فرمت پشتیبانی می‌کنن، در اختیار بازدیدکنندگان قرار بدین. بعد از نصب این افزونه، به تنظیمات کش در داشبورد خود برین و ایجاد یه نسخه اضافی ذخیره شده برای پشتیبانی از این فرمت رو انتخاب کنین.

با هر یک از این روش‌ها می‌تونین کار رو به اتمام برسونین، بنابراین شما می‌تونین از افزونه‌های مورد نظر خود استفاده کنین. در این حالت افزایش کارایی در وب سایت شما می‌تونه چشم‌گیر باشه. بنابراین اگه سایت شما تصاویر با سایز زیادی داره، ارزش راه اندازی یکی از این راه حل‌ها رو داره.

نتیجه

با توجه به تاثیر بسیار زیاد در زمان بارگذاری تقریباً هر سایت یا رسانه اجتماعی می‌تونه از فرمت عکس WebP بهره مند باشه. همونطور که در موارد و جنبه‌های مثبت و منفی این فرمت گفتیم، پرچم قرمز به شکل واضحی بیان‌گر این موضوع هست که همه مرورگرها از اون استفاده نمی‌کنن، حتماً با تجزیه و تحلیل استفاده خود دوباره بررسی کنین تا ببینین کدوم مرورگرها بازدیدکنندگان شما رو ترجیح می‌دن و آیا تبدیل به فرمت WebP بر اونها موثر هست یا نه! اگه هنوز مطمئن نیستین که فرمت تصویر مناسب شما هست، همیشه این گزینه رو دارین تا یه طراح وب حرفه‌ای استخدام کنین تا این مسئله رو برای شما مدیریت کنه. فقط کافیه ذکر کنین که سرعت سایت و زمان بارگذاری از الویت بالایی برخوردار هست. در نهایت باید بگیم که به جواب سوال خود رسیدین.

پرسش
WebP چیه؟

باید به عنوان جمع بندی بگیم که یه نوع پرونده تصویری هست که حتی در استفاده از PNGهای فشرده یا JPEG نیز می‌تونه سرعت وب سایت شما رو افزایش بده. این فرمت یکی از روش‌های بهبود سرعت سایت شما هست. فرمت WebP بدون معایب وجود نداره اما می‌تونه اندازه پرونده‌های کوچک‌تر رو با کیفیت قابل مقایسه‌ای تولید کنه. توجه کنین که محبوبیت اون در حال افزایش هست اما این مسئله رو مد نظر داشته باشین که این فرمت در همه مرورگرها پشتیبانی نمی‌‎شه. سعی کردیم در مورد فرمت WebP اطلاعات مناسبی در اختیار شما بذاریم. سوالات و نظرات خود رو با ما به اشتراک بذارین.